DEATHS

CAVE—On November 19, 1950, at Wanganui, Helena Susannah Dawson, beloved wife of the late Kenneth Holmes Cave, of Wanganui, and loved mother of Maurice Cave; in her 71st yea?.

Friends are respectfully informed that the funeral will leave St. Lawrence's Anglican Church, Gibson St., Aramoho, tomorrow (Wednesday, November 22, 1950), for the Aramoho Cemetery, at the conclusion of service which will commence at 11 a.m.— Fleming and Dick.

CABLE—On November 20, 1950, at Wanganui, Linda Marua (ex-Waaf No. 3530), dearly beloved daughter of Violet E. M. and the late Alexander Cable, of Port Chalmers, and loved sister of Mrs. Frank Farmer (Waikouaiti), Ralph (Lower Hutt), and Mrs. Eric Lawrence (Durie Hill). No flowers by request. Private < remation. —Fleming and Dick.

KLATT—On November 20, 1950, at Palmerston North, Mary Kathleen, dearly loved wife of Phil Ashly Klatt, of 261 Victoria Avenue, Palmerston North, and loving mother of Jennifer, Beverley and Susanne, and beloved daughter of Mrs. and the late Mr. J. A. Harkness; Wanganui; aged 32 years. Friends are advised that a service will be held at St. Peter’s Church, Palmerston North, today (Tuesday, November 21, 1950), at 11.30 a.m.), and later at 2.30 p.m., at the Crematorium, Wanganui.—Thos. Griggs and Son, Funeral Directors, Palmerston North.

WHITEFORD—On November 19, 1950, at the residence of her daughter, Mrs. A. Lockett, No. 10 Swiss Avenue, Gonvillc, Euphemia, beloved wife of the late './1111am Whiteford, of Wellington : in her 90th year. Friends kindly note that the funeral will leave St. Paul’s Presbyterian Church, Wanganui, for the Karori Cemetery, Wellington, on Wednesday, November 22, 1950, at the conclusion of a service commencing at 9.30 a.m. —Dempsey and Sons.
